24.3.9 Debug Comparator A Extension Register (DBG_CAX)
NOTE
All the bits in this register reset to 0 in POR or non-end-run
reset. The bits are undefined in end-run reset. In the case of an
end-trace to reset where DBGEN = 1 and BEGIN = 0, the bits
in this register do not change after reset.

DBG_CAX field descriptions
Field Description
7
RWAEN
Read/Write Comparator A Enable Bit
The RWAEN bit controls whether read or write comparison is enabled for Comparator A.
0 Read/Write is not used in comparison.
1 Read/Write is used in comparison.
6
RWA
Read/Write Comparator A Value Bit
The RWA bit controls whether read or write is used in compare for Comparator A. The RWA bit is not used
if RWAEN = 0.
0 Write cycle will be matched.
1 Read cycle will be matched.
5–0
Reserved
This field is reserved.
This read-only field is reserved and always has the value 0.
